Mastering Heat Shrink Techniques for Indoor Cable Connections
Securing reliable indoor cable connections requires mastering heat shrink techniques. Utilizing the right tools and methods can ensure a clean, professional coupled with weatherproof finish.
To achieve optimal results, you'll need a selection of heat shrink tubing in various diameters, a high-quality heat gun, and possibly some additional tools depending on the complexity of your project.
Always prioritize safety by wearing protective gear like gloves and eye protection when working with hot tools.
Start by stripping back the insulation of your cables to expose the bare wires. Then, carefully slide the heat shrink tubing over the exposed wires before joining them together using appropriate connectors or wiring. Once assembled, apply heat from your heat gun in a smooth, even motion across the tubing until it contracts and forms a tight seal.
Remember to always check for proper insulation coverage and ensure that there are no gaps or unprotected wires after applying heat.
Mastering these techniques through experimentation and observation will allow you to create secure indoor cable connections that are built to last.

Optimize Indoor Wiring: A Guide to Heat Shrink Termination
When dealing with indoor wiring projects, ensuring a secure and reliable connection is paramount. Heat shrink connectors play a vital role in achieving this goal by providing insulation and protection against electrical faults. Properly installing heat shrink connections involves several key processes. First, strip the insulation from the wire tips to the desired length. Next, insert the stripped wire into the correct heat shrink sleeve and secure it with a terminal. Once assembled, apply heat from a heat gun or torch until the heat shrink material contracts snugly around the wire interface.
- For optimal results, it's crucial to use heat shrink tubing that are designed for the appropriate voltage and current.
- Refrain from applying excessive heat, as this can damage the wire or the heat shrink material.
- Allow sufficient time for the heat shrink to cool completely before testing the connection.
By implementing these simple steps, you can achieve professional-quality heat shrink terminations that will enhance the reliability and longevity of your indoor wiring installations.
